前後端分離ajax接收檔案流的實踐

2021-07-24 04:34:30 字數 646 閱讀 5420

function

exportrecord() ;

var form = $("");

form.attr('style', 'display:none');

form.attr('target', '');

form.attr('method', 'post'); //請求方式

form.attr('action', ip+'exportrecord.do');//請求位址

var input1 = $('');//將你請求的資料模仿成乙個input表單

input1.attr('type', 'hidden');

input1.attr('name', 'json');//該輸入框的name

input1.attr('value',json.stringify(json));//該輸入框的值

form.submit();

form.remove();

}

這種方法發出的請求格式類似於username=username&password=password. **中的name就是請求中的key,**中的value就是請求資料中的value

然後後台採用老辦法,往response裡寫檔案流,往前臺推。

by:

ajax前後端分離

本週內容 今日內容 ajax結合sweetalert實現刪除按鈕動態效果 bulk create批量插入資料 自定義分頁器 多對多三種建立方式 明日內容 forms元件 cookies與session操作 django中介軟體 跨站請求偽造csrf auth模組 bbs小作業 fbv 上週內容回顧 ...

django 前後端分離,ajax

1.直接在前端呼叫第三方的介面 三門峽今日天氣 轉 到 2.呼叫自己資料庫 帶分頁的 後端 csrf exempt def get tongzhi request code 200 msg success 獲取全部資料 tongzhis all list article.objects.filter...

前後端的分離

對於大部分應用,已經不需要從後端讀取html頁面或者模板,前端完全可以根據資料自行渲染頁面 模板,這樣,前後臺互動就可以簡化為資料的增刪改查。利用ajax技術,實現頁面區域性重新整理,促使了前後臺分離的可能性。那麼,如何利用前後端分離開發模式,開始乙個專案呢?1.產品文件 產品經理會先設計好整個產品...